The Mahatma Gandhi Memorial: A Tribute to Peace and Heritage

Discover the Mahatma Gandhi Memorial in Little India, Singapore, a serene tribute to peace and a cultural landmark celebrating Indian heritage.

4.8

Nestled in the heart of Singapore's vibrant Little India, the Mahatma Gandhi Memorial is a poignant tribute to the life and legacy of one of the world's most revered leaders. This memorial estate offers visitors a serene space to reflect on Gandhi's principles of non-violence and social justice. With its beautiful architecture and rich historical significance, it stands as a cultural landmark that celebrates the Indian heritage and the enduring spirit of peace.

Getting There

  • Car

    From Holland Village, head east on Holland Road toward the Bukit Timah Road. Continue straight for about 2.5 km. Merge onto the Pan Island Expressway (PIE) and follow signs for the Central Business District. Take exit 14A toward Balestier Road. Continue on Balestier Road for approximately 1.5 km, then turn left onto Race Course Lane. The Mahatma Gandhi Memorial will be on your right at 3 Race Course Lane, Singapore 218731. Parking is available nearby, but may incur fees.

  • Public Transportation

    From Holland Village, walk to the Holland Village MRT station (approximately 5 minutes). Take the Circle Line MRT towards Dhoby Ghaut and alight at Little India MRT Station (about 10 minutes). Exit the station and head east on Serangoon Road. Continue straight for about 500 meters until you reach Race Course Lane. Turn left onto Race Course Lane, and the Mahatma Gandhi Memorial will be on your right at 3 Race Course Lane, Singapore 218731. Public transport fares apply.

  • Taxi/Grab

    If you prefer a more direct route, you can take a taxi or book a Grab from Holland Village. Simply enter 'Mahatma Gandhi Memorial, 3 Race Course Lane, Singapore 218731' as your destination in the app. The journey should take about 15-20 minutes depending on traffic. The cost typically ranges from SGD 10 to SGD 15.

Discover more about Mahatma Gandhi Memorial

Situated in the bustling neighborhood of Little India, the Mahatma Gandhi Memorial serves as a significant homage to the life of Mahatma Gandhi, the iconic leader of India's independence movement. This memorial estate is not just a site of remembrance; it embodies the principles of peace and non-violence that Gandhi passionately advocated throughout his life. Visitors can appreciate the intricate architectural details of the memorial, which harmoniously blend with the vibrant surroundings of Little India. The estate is adorned with sculptures and plaques that narrate Gandhi's story and his impact on social justice, making it a poignant learning experience for all who visit. As you explore the memorial grounds, take a moment to soak in the serenity that contrasts with the lively atmosphere of the nearby streets. This is a perfect spot for reflection and gaining insight into India's rich history and cultural heritage. The site often attracts tourists and locals alike, drawn by its significance and the peaceful ambiance it offers. Additionally, the memorial's location makes it an excellent starting point for exploring other nearby attractions, including the colorful temples and bustling markets of Little India, where visitors can experience the delightful flavors and vibrant culture of the Indian community in Singapore. The Mahatma Gandhi Memorial also serves as a venue for cultural events and exhibitions that promote understanding and appreciation of Indian art and heritage. Whether you are a history enthusiast or simply seeking a tranquil escape, this memorial estate provides a unique opportunity to connect with the values of peace and solidarity that Gandhi championed, making it a must-visit destination for tourists seeking a deeper understanding of Singapore's multicultural tapestry.
